Man charged in Warren murder indicted on new charge
WARREN — A city man already at the Trumbull County jail on a charge of aggravated murder for a March 31 homicide in Warren was indicted Wednesday on a charge of possession of a deadly weapon while under detention, according to a Trumbull County grand jury report. Serroyan J. Couto, 19, is accused of having a weapon inside the jail on May 19. No further details on the case were provided.
